Segra is searching for a dynamic and experienced Field Service Engineer to work within our Richmond, VA market .

The Field Service Engineer is responsible for the day-to-day activities of the network, including but not limited to equipment installation & commissioning, circuit / node turn-up & testing, customer premise equipment, (Ethernet Network Interface Devices, Routers, Data Switches, premise Firewalls, IAD's, Hosted phones, ONT's, preventive maintenance, and testing / troubleshooting associated with transport infrastructure, switching infrastructure and IP / Data networks.

Field Operations personnel will perform "on call" duties as required. The FSE will interact with internal and external customers, service technicians, technical support personnel and other telecom professionals.

Required Qualifications :

  • Knowledge of Telecom equipment (ex.- Cisco, Ciena, etc.)
  • Experience working with fiber optic fibers in some capacity
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ience with Telecom equipment

Preferred Qualifications :

  • Associate's degree or technical field (industry related) preferred, and / or a combination of job-related experience.
  • Cisco and / or Ciena equipment experience preferred.
  • AC / DC core fundamentals; good driving record; Office 365 suite.
  • Understanding and use of engineering documents.
  • Able to understand and operate advanced industry test sets, DS1-100G, OTDR and fiber scopes.
  • Knowledgeable and skilled with DC power to support tertiary power applications.
  • Work independently with limited supervision.
  • Assumes all routine tasks for major projects and is periodically called upon to make routine decisions.
